    Thanks and I hear ya DanSavage! It will definitely be worth the wait...my 6mmBR is a blast to shoot. And you are correct on the higher mag. I was shootin a vortex PST 6-24x50 FFP but just installed a nightforce benchrest 8-32x56 on my 6mmBR and here are a few recent targets.

    yesterday I had the best 4-shot group at 100 yds that I have ever pulled the trigger on.


    And today shootin' 80 gr Berger Varmint with Varget 30.0 gr at 500 yds was just plain fun! After the group on the right side of the gong...I played around with the nightforce a little.
